Software test automation in a crossdevelopment environment: Evaluating the Effectiveness of Patrol and Appium

Abstract [en]

This study examines the effectiveness of two software testing frameworks, Patrol andAppium, for automating software testing in cross-platform mobile app development, witha focus on Flutter applications. The study assesses their capabilities in handling thecomplexities of mobile app testing, particularly in scenarios involving localization, crossplatform compatibility, integration with hardware components and Bluetoothcommunication. By understanding the features and challenges associated with Patrol andAppium, the study aims to provide valuable insights for software teams seeking tooptimize their software testing processes. The research highlights the practicalimplications of choosing the proper testing framework and offers actionablerecommendations for improving testing efficiency and reliability in Flutter developmentprojects. Overall, this study contributes to the broader discourse on software engineeringmethodologies, offering practical guidance for developers, project managers, andorganizations navigating the challenges of cross-platform mobile app development.
